Translation Of Virgin Galactic In Different Languages

Translate VIRGIN GALACTIC in languages spoken worldwide

English
Ways to say virgin galactic
Virgin galactic

Translate VIRGIN GALACTIC in European languages

English
Ways to say virgin galactic
Virgin galactic